How the Recommended Calorie Intake Calculator Works

This calculator estimates your daily calorie needs based on scientifically accepted formulas. It first calculates your Basal Metabolic Rate (BMR), which represents the number of calories your body needs at rest. Then it adjusts this value according to your activity level to determine your Total Daily Energy Expenditure (TDEE).

Key Inputs Required:

To get accurate results, users typically need to provide:

  • Age
  • Gender
  • Weight (kg or lbs)
  • Height (cm or feet/inches)
  • Activity level (sedentary, lightly active, moderately active, very active)
  • Fitness goal (weight loss, maintenance, or weight gain)

Core Calculation Logic:

One of the most commonly used formulas is the Mifflin-St Jeor Equation:

  • For men:
    BMR = (10 × weight) + (6.25 × height) − (5 × age) + 5
  • For women:
    BMR = (10 × weight) + (6.25 × height) − (5 × age) − 161

Then:

TDEE = BMR × Activity Factor

Activity factors typically include:

  • Sedentary: 1.2
  • Light activity: 1.375
  • Moderate activity: 1.55
  • Very active: 1.725
  • Extra active: 1.9

Finally, the calculator adjusts calories based on goals:

  • Weight loss: subtract 10–25% calories
  • Weight gain: add 10–20% calories
  • Maintenance: keep TDEE unchanged

Practical Example

Let’s understand with a real-life example:

  • Age: 25
  • Gender: Male
  • Weight: 70 kg
  • Height: 175 cm
  • Activity Level: Moderately active
  • Goal: Weight loss

Step 1: BMR Calculation

BMR = (10 × 70) + (6.25 × 175) − (5 × 25) + 5
BMR = 700 + 1093.75 − 125 + 5 = 1673.75

Step 2: TDEE Calculation

TDEE = 1673.75 × 1.55 = 2594 calories/day (approx.)

Step 3: Weight Loss Adjustment

For weight loss (20% deficit):
2594 − 518 ≈ 2076 calories/day

So, this user should consume around 2075 calories per day for healthy weight loss.

Why Calorie Tracking Matters

Calorie tracking is one of the most effective ways to manage body weight. Consuming more calories than you burn leads to weight gain, while consuming fewer leads to weight loss. However, doing this blindly can be ineffective.

A Recommended Calorie Intake Calculator ensures that your diet is aligned with your body’s actual energy needs, making your fitness journey more scientific and reliable.


Common Mistakes People Make

  • Ignoring activity level when calculating calories
  • Following extreme low-calorie diets
  • Not adjusting intake as body weight changes
  • Overestimating exercise calories burned
  • Not tracking food intake consistently

Avoiding these mistakes can significantly improve results.
